Peer to Peer (P2P) là một mạng lưới các thiết bị lưu trữ với khả năng chia sẻ tài nguyên và tính linh hoạt, nó được sử dụng rộng rãi trong các doanh nghiệp. Vậy chính xác thì Peer to Peer là gì? P2P có tính năng gì đặc biệt? cùng tìm hiểu qua bài viết dưới đây nhé!
- ROS là gì? Công thức tính và cách đọc chỉ số ROS
- Rose coin là gì? Toàn tập từ A – Z về dự án Oasis Network (ROSE)
- Rủi ro tỷ giá là gì? Tác động của rủi ro tỷ giá lên thị trường Forex
- Sách Nhà Đầu Tư Thông Minh PDF – Review chi tiết
Peer to Peer là gì?
Mạng ngang hàng (P2P) là một mô hình mạng phân tán trong đó tất cả các bên sử dụng cùng một cấu trúc phiên giao tiếp. Mỗi nút đóng vai trò là máy khách và máy chủ của hệ thống, giúp việc truyền dữ liệu giữa các nút dễ dàng hơn và nhanh hơn.
Cơ chế hoạt động của mạng P2P
Thông thường, người dùng phải tìm kiếm và tải xuống tệp mong muốn bằng trình duyệt web của mình. Trang web đóng vai trò như một máy chủ và máy tính hoạt động như một máy khách để nhận dữ liệu. Nói cách khác, quy trình tương tự như đường một chiều từ A đến B, với tải tại A và máy tính tại B.
Mạng ngang hàng (P2P) sẽ tự cung cấp một quy trình hoạt động khác. Người dùng trước tiên phải cài đặt phần mềm P2P trước khi được đưa vào mạng ảo chung do P2P tạo.
Một tệp mạng ảo sẽ được tải xuống và nhận dưới dạng các Bit được tạo sẵn từ nhiều máy tính khác nhau. Đồng thời, dữ liệu sẽ được máy tính yêu cầu nhận từ máy tính của người dùng. P2P hoạt động như một con đường hai chiều trong trường hợp này, cho phép truyền tệp phân tán linh hoạt hơn.
Các mô hình của mạng ngang hàng
Mạng ngang hàng không có cấu trúc, có cấu trúc và cấu trúc lai là 3 mô hình chính của mạng ngang hàng. Mỗi kiểu kiến trúc sẽ có những đặc điểm riêng như sau:
P2P không có cấu trúc
Các nút trong mạng ngang hàng không có cấu trúc sẽ không tuân theo bất kỳ cấu trúc cụ thể nào. Những người tham gia giao tiếp với nhau một cách ngẫu nhiên. Các hệ thống này nhằm hạn chế sự không tham gia của người dùng (Một số nút thường xuyên tham gia và rời khỏi mạng).
Mặc dù mạng P2P không có cấu trúc dễ thiết lập hơn nhưng nó có thể cần nhiều thời gian và bộ nhớ CPU vì truy vấn tìm kiếm được gửi đến càng nhiều dữ liệu càng tốt. Nếu chỉ một vài nút cung cấp nội dung cần thiết, mạng sẽ trở nên quá tải.
P2P có cấu trúc
Các Node của mạng P2P có kiến trúc tổ chức, cho phép các nút tìm kiếm tệp một cách hiệu quả, ngay cả khi nội dung không phổ biến. Trong những trường hợp này, các hàm băm với khả năng tra cứu cơ sở dữ liệu được sử dụng.
P2P có mức độ tập trung cao hơn, giúp cấu trúc hoạt động hiệu quả hơn, nhưng quá trình này có thể tốn kém và yêu cầu bảo trì hệ thống thường xuyên. Hơn nữa, P2P có thể hoạt động kém khi người dùng rời mạng với số lượng lớn.
P2P cấu trúc lai
Kiến trúc lai P2P kết hợp giữa kiến trúc máy khách và máy chủ truyền thống với một số yếu tố kiến trúc ngang hàng.
Khi so sánh với hai kiến trúc còn lại, các mô hình lai thường vượt trội hơn hẳn. Chúng kết hợp các lợi ích chính của mỗi phương pháp, dẫn đến hiệu quả và phân cấp đáng kể.
Ưu nhược điểm của mạng Peer to Peer
Ưu điểm
Cấu trúc của mạng ngang hàng được duy trì bởi một cộng đồng người dùng có thể vừa cung cấp vừa sử dụng tài nguyên. P2P khác với mô hình máy khách – máy chủ truyền thống ở chỗ không có khái niệm máy chủ trung tâm hay máy chủ lưu trữ. Bởi vì P2P tập trung vào khách hàng, cấu trúc của nó cung cấp cho người dùng những lợi thế sau:
- Không cần sử dụng máy chủ.
- Mỗi thiết bị máy tính đều có người dùng quản lý riêng.
- P2P không yêu cầu bất kỳ kiến thức kỹ thuật chuyên ngành nào.
- Một mạng ngang hàng thích hợp cho việc sử dụng gia đình và doanh nghiệp nhỏ.
- Giảm lưu lượng mạng khi truy cập.
Nhược điểm
Mạng ngang hàng có một số nhược điểm bên cạnh những ưu điểm của chúng, như sau:
- Thông tin trên máy không cho phép sao lưu tập trung.
- Việc cho phép nhiều thiết bị máy tính kết nối cùng lúc sẽ làm giảm hiệu suất.
- Các tập tin không được sắp xếp khoa học mà được lưu trên máy tính cá nhân nên rất khó tìm kiếm.
- Tất cả người dùng chịu trách nhiệm về an ninh mạng.
- Nó chỉ cung cấp các quyền cơ bản và không có bảo mật nâng cao.
Do tính chất phi tập trung của P2P, rất khó để kiểm soát trong các trường hợp điều tra rửa tiền, bị tấn công mạng,…. Hơn nữa, khi sử dụng mạng ngang hàng, phải cần một lượng lớn công suất tính toán. Do đó, đây vừa là ưu điểm vừa là nhược điểm của P2P. Hy vọng, qua bài viết của Sanuytin.com về Peer to Peer là gì? giúp cho nhà đầu tư nắm vững cách sử dụng P2P hiệu quả.